The Graphic Artist's Guild Guide is a valuable resource for artists, providing information on pricing, contracts, and ethical practices. However, the Kindle version of the book is poorly formatted and difficult to read. Despite this, the content itself is highly informative and useful. Overall, the book is recommended for artists looking to improve their business skills and pricing strategies.

This book is great, and it's full of useful information that is absolutely indispensable. My only complaint is the pricing tables that were in previous editions are gone in some spots. I'm thinking specifically of the tables for pricing things like movie posters in the illustration section and I'm sure there are other tables missing.

Most of the pictures within this ebook either aren't rendering or are such poor scans that you can't make out a thing on the page. This wouldn't be a problem if the text within ebook itself were formatted in such a way as to be clear itself; however, it's not. Tables in the published book are just sets of paragraphs in the ebook that don't align. There's no way to tell what is supposed to line up where, so if you're looking for pricing guidance - good luck! Within the text blocks that are legible, there are random characters throughout making everything hard to read. Errors, poor formatting, and blurry scans abound so I wouldn't recommend purchasing this ebook.
